Output 6fc66c8c9d2d0e9d70a90891f6c5df7ed8c7a6f7b1947d18bb601fa66e6c89cb:0

value
8600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de131e946ccca1f418724daa6849519e74176c52 OP_EQUAL
address
3MwEqaBdK3QA56ZhhSoWS2btKUbpuFpMsG
transaction
6fc66c8c9d2d0e9d70a90891f6c5df7ed8c7a6f7b1947d18bb601fa66e6c89cb
confirmations
135682
spent
true